[ https://issues.apache.org/jira/browse/SOLR-1449?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12761488#action_12761488 ]
Shalin Shekhar Mangar commented on SOLR-1449: --------------------------------------------- Hoss, Noble has been refactoring SolrConfig in SOLR-1198 with the end goal being pluggable loading of SolrConfig. This makes SOLR-919 and SOLR-1293 easier. But it is also about how we want SolrPlugins to be loaded. Ideally they'd keep configuration in SolrConfig but the actual loading will happen in SolrCore or somewhere else outside. A large part of work for SOLR-1198 has been done in 1.4. This patch also marked for 1.4 goes against that example by modifying the resource loader. So we need to ask now what is the function of SolrConfig? Do we want it to load/modify SolrResourceLoader objects or just be a representation of configuration? > solrconfig.xml syntax to add classpath elements from outside of instanceDir > --------------------------------------------------------------------------- > > Key: SOLR-1449 > URL: https://issues.apache.org/jira/browse/SOLR-1449 > Project: Solr > Issue Type: Improvement > Reporter: Hoss Man > Assignee: Hoss Man > Fix For: 1.4 > > Attachments: SOLR-1449.patch, SOLR-1449.patch, SOLR-1449.patch, > SOLR-1449.patch, SOLR-1449.patch, SOLR-1449.patch, SOLR-1449.patch > > > the idea has been discussed numerous times that it would be nice if there was > a way to configure a core to load plugins from specific jars (or "classes" > style directories) by path w/o needing to copy them to the "./lib" dir in > the instanceDir. > The current workaround is "symlinks" but that doesn't really help the > situation of the Solr Release artifacts, where we wind up making numerous > copies of jars to support multiple example directories (you can't have > reliable symlinks in zip files) -- This message is automatically generated by JIRA. - You can reply to this email to add a comment to the issue online.